AboutThisCourse

In high demand, literature advocates are needed to promote literacy, support authors, and preserve cultural heritage. This course provides learners with the knowledge and tools to design and implement effective literature advocacy campaigns, engage with diverse communities, and evaluate the impact of their initiatives. Through a combination of lectures, case studies, and interactive exercises, learners will develop skills in research, writing, project management, and community engagement. By the end of the course, learners will have a comprehensive understanding of literature advocacy and the practical skills necessary to advance their careers and make a positive impact on the world.
